Hi All, Is there a way to set up the Net Carbs on our daily food diary? If not - would the correct way to calculate Net Carbs by taking the Carbs minus the Fiber ? I'm new to this lifestyle so I'm learning and am open for any and all suggestions and friends.

    I changed my Sugar column to Fiber & just do the math myself (carbs - fiber since you're in the US). Here's a link to some tips on tweaking MFP to get Net Carbs:

    Personally I look at both total carbs and fiber, so mentally calculate net carbs by subtracting the fiber from the total carbs. I find both pieces of information useful, as for nutritional ketosis 50 g or fewer total carbs a day is what's recommended for most people. I don't subtract sugar alcohols, therefore I don't eat them very often.
